This place was very good. We went on a Friday and made a reservation. We asked to be inside and to be able to see the local artist of the day play music. The place was packed but our place was reserved as promised. The restaurant has 3 areas. The main floor were the bar is has around 6 or 7 tables and a sofa area. The second area can be reserved for parties, has a few tables and a sitting area and is divided from the main area by a type of island that overlooks towards the small stage (that is where we sat). Outside there is a nice patio (that could use a bit more ambiance or plant decor.
The food menu consist of mostly tablas ir what other may call tapas... Variety of cheese, olives, dips, salads and light snacks to have while you enjoy a flight of wines.
Overall the experience was great but the place was very loud (we went there to celebrate our anniversary), it could use better sound proofing and a partition maybe in between areas, you had to literally tell at your party to carry on a conversation. Although if you probably visit during the week you could carry on a proper conversation and take advantage of their offers.
If you are a wine lover, you can become a member as well and enjoy some of their perks of trying new varieties and getting some type of discount.
Age groups visiting the place range from late twenty to people's on their sixties, most customers on their 40s and 50s.
